Have you heard of ESG?

ESG stands for Environmental, Social and Governance. These three factors are key when measuring the sustainability and ethical impact of a business, whether it's a start-up, SME, or large corporate.

Join our free climate support programme

Designed to support SMEs in reducing costs, whilst lowering carbon emissions.

We’ve partnered with the Edinburgh Climate Change Institute and the University of Edinburgh to bring Scottish businesses a unique programme, free of charge.

  • Practical workshops and unique learning resources to support small businesses in making their vital contribution to Scotland’s national target for net zero emissions by 2045, helping them to be ready to succeed in the future net zero economy.
  • Delivered through three, two-hour online workshops, the programme will give SMEs the knowledge, tools, and confidence to take meaningful action on their net zero journey.
  • Learn from experts in the net zero economy, share experiences and learn from each other. Leaving the programme with a carbon footprint and reduction plan, filled with practical steps on how to cut costs and carbon. 
  • And equipping them with the ability to communicate their climate strategy with others to support the tender process, meet regulation and have a positive impact on customers.

This programme is available to any Scotland based business with a turnover of up to £25m.
